Very Good Cornet Mouthpiece
The Blessing 3C cornet mouthpiece turned out to be as good as the flugelhorn and trumpet mouthpiece I recently purchased ,even though the postal delivery was to the wrong apartment in my building! My neighbor returned the package to me . Ok so the playing of the cornet with the new Blessing mouthpiece has been going very well compared to myBach cornet mouthpieces which I have several sizes,I don't know for sure why but it could be the rim size of the Blessing 3 is larger than my Bachs like a Bach 7C original mouthpiece with the cornet,and a Bach 5C. I believe a wider rim is the way to go for me ,but time will tell. Playing points,slurs are excellent and smooth with the Blessing 3C,going from low to high notes is smoother and comfortable,and finally the tone is fuller due to the larger rim size and the moderate cup depth C. At the price of the Blessing which is about half of the usual Bach price. All things together I would highly advise get a Blessing mouthpiece for your cornet,trumpet or flugelhorn(very nice flugel mouthpiece)Just one other point I notice the Bach mouthpieces at the shank have no bevel and on the Blessing as well as the Jet Tone mouthpieces have a smooth bevel at the shank end which iis there for a reason,and I believe it helps the airstream move smoothly thru the receiver of the trumpet or cornet. The somewhat rough edge of the shank of the Bach mouthpiece may not seem important,but then why do other mouthpiece makers take care and make sure the end of the shank is nicely beveled? I am not an expert by any means ,this is something I have noticed and not seen or heard from trumpet players about this facet of the mouthpiece. I do know the mouthpieces with the bevel shank seem to play very well.
